วิธีบังคับให้ Ubuntu เข้าถึงอินเทอร์เน็ตผ่าน VPN เท่านั้นและปิดการใช้งานเมื่อตัดการเชื่อมต่อ


12

เนื่องจากปัญหาความเป็นส่วนตัวฉันต้องการให้ Ubuntu อนุญาตให้แอปพลิเคชันส่งทราฟฟิกไปยังอินเทอร์เน็ตเฉพาะเมื่อมีการสร้างการเชื่อมต่อ VPN

ประเด็นก็คือมีแอปพลิเคชั่นบางอย่างเช่น Skype หรือ Dropbox ที่จะเชื่อมต่อใหม่หลังจากการเชื่อมต่อ VPN ถูกทิ้งด้วยสาเหตุบางประการ และฉันไม่ต้องการสิ่งนั้นฉันต้องการให้พวกเขาไม่สามารถ

มีวิธีใดในการทำเช่นนี้?


ซ้ำกันเป็นไปได้ที่นี่หรือที่นี่ ?
Tom Brossman

คำตอบ:


1

ลองสิ่งนี้:

ในการรับ IP เกตเวย์เริ่มต้นของคุณให้แสดงเส้นทางของคุณด้วยip route listคำสั่ง

แก้ไขการเชื่อมต่ออินเทอร์เน็ตหลักของคุณเพื่อลบเส้นทางเริ่มต้น: ในnm-connection-editor, แก้ไขการเชื่อมต่อของคุณ> แท็บ IPv4> เส้นทาง> ตรวจสอบใช้การเชื่อมต่อนี้สำหรับทรัพยากรในเครือข่ายของมันเท่านั้น

จากนั้นเพิ่มเส้นทางเฉพาะเพื่อเข้าถึงเซิร์ฟเวอร์ VPN ผ่านเกตเวย์ของคุณ วิธีนี้จะช่วยให้คอมพิวเตอร์ของคุณเข้าถึง IP เดียวเท่านั้นบนอินเทอร์เน็ต: เซิร์ฟเวอร์ VPN ของคุณเพื่อให้การเชื่อมต่อ VPN ของคุณยังคงทำงานได้ (ในหน้าต่างเส้นทางเพิ่มเส้นทางที่ชอบ: Adress: VPN_SERVER_IP Netmask: 255.255.255.255 Gateway:GATEWAY_IP)

หากต้องการอนุญาตการเข้าถึงอินเทอร์เน็ตผ่าน VPN ของคุณคุณอาจต้องแก้ไข Routes ของการเชื่อมต่อ VPN ของคุณเพื่อยกเลิกการเลือก "ใช้การเชื่อมต่อนี้เฉพาะสำหรับทรัพยากรบนเครือข่ายของตน" หรือเพิ่มเส้นทางเฉพาะสำหรับเกตเวย์ที่กำหนดเองของ VPN

หน้าจอแก้ไขเส้นทางแก้ไข nm-connection-editor


2
ดูเหมือนว่าจะใช้งานไม่ได้ใน Ubuntu 13.04 ฉันไม่สามารถเชื่อมต่อกับ OpenVPN ของฉันถ้าฉันทำตามคำแนะนำเหล่านี้ @Marc คุณสามารถอัปเดตคำแนะนำสำหรับ Ubuntu รุ่นล่าสุดได้หรือไม่
Hengjie
โ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.